Mountain Falls Golf Course
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gold | 72 | 7082 yards | 72.7 | 129 |
| Gold/Blue | 72 | 6829 yards | 71.4 | 127 |
| Blue | 72 | 6608 yards | 70.1 | 123 |
| Blue/White | 72 | 6328 yards | 68.8 | 119 |
| White | 72 | 6101 yards | 68.1 | 112 |
| White (W) | 72 | 6101 yards | 73.8 | 132 |
| Green | 72 | 5389 yards | 64.2 | 99 |
| Green (W) | 72 | 5389 yards | 69.4 | 124 |

Great course
Nice drive out from Vegas. Course was in great shape and very interesting to play.
Well worth the Drive
I've played this course about 50 times over the past 2 years..Yes it's a bit of a drive..BUT a very easy relaxing drive from Vegas..This course is always in perfect shape...greens roll true and are challenging...course layout has a nice mix of dessert & water...can't beat the pace of play..usually takes 3 hrs to 3 1/2...pricing is very fair(50-70$)depending on time of the year.The restaurant has excellent food and the prices are rather cheap..Honestly I'd give this place a 6 star rating if I could..Vegas should learn a thing or 2 for how they run their operations...This staff actually gives a crap.
Excellent Course well worth playing
This is an excellent course and great value for the money for what we paid. Some really interesting holes. Greens were difficult to read but true.
Grill restaurant was excellent value for money and well worth staying to eat.
One of my favorite courses around Vegas, specially the last nine holes. I always try to go there if I am around. It is worse the 50 miles drive from town. Our round was only 3,5 hours. Not many people on the course. Very relaxing round. Fairways and greens in good condition. Bunkers ok but the sand is not really good - more fine gravel than sand. Nice restaurant with friendly stuff and good terrace to enjoy food and drinks after the round.

A hidden gem
Everything about our experience at this course was 1st class. If we could have given them 6 stars we would have!
Staff were helpful, extremely helpful, even moving us as a 2 ball ahead of a 4 ball on the 1st tee. Both groups were told of this change when we were warming up in the well kept practice ground.
The course was immaculate, with the exception of a few ball marks left by uncaring golfers. Great shame that people don't look after the course for others behind them.
The pro shop staff were very open to suggestions of reminding players to repair ball marks. The green keeping staff to an incredible job in maintaining the course to an exceptional level and it must be frustrating when they see what golfers do to their final result.
Would we come back? ABSOLUTELY! Well worth the drive out to Pahrump.

Test of Patience
What a disaster! Unfortunately I played on a day they had an outside tournament. Not a problem, I made an afternoon tee time. Golf course let the tournament add 15 more entrants which fouled up the afternoon tee times for players. The staff seemed to not know what to do when their tee times were fouled up. When I arrived I was told to ask the Marshall when I was to start—no organization at all. I paired up with different people throughout my round. There was a 10-15 minute wait on each hole. I was told this was not the usual pace of play for Mountain Falls. Locals said it was usually fast moving, but based on my experience I find it hard to believe. Surprised the Marshall was not able to get things moving. I’m also surprised the staff was not able to give people a tee time based on what they had posted on the books. I’d be hard pressed to play this course again even though it was not one of their regular days and it is a nice course. The disappointing thing was the way the staff handled the situation—they were friendly but had no idea what to do.
